## 🫀 FDA PMA Approval & Supplement Change Intelligence

Monitor high-risk Class III medical-device approvals and understand what each PMA supplement actually changes. Results combine official decision data with deterministic materiality, review timing and competitive activity signals.

### 📤 What you get

- original PMAs and supplements with stable decision keys;
- supplement type, reason and full FDA approval-order statement;
- high/medium/low materiality based on new indications, clinical evidence, safety, design, labeling and manufacturing changes;
- review duration, expedited status and decision code;
- applicant and product-code activity counts inside the selected window;
- device identity, specialty, FEI/registration IDs, applicant address and direct FDA evidence links.

Use `minimumMateriality: "high"` to isolate panel-track supplements, indication expansions and other commercially meaningful changes. Schedule a weekly run for medtech competitive intelligence, regulatory monitoring or business-development leads.

Data comes from the official openFDA PMA endpoint, updated monthly.

### 📥 Complete input reference

| Field | Type | Default | Purpose |
|---|---|---:|---|
| `keywords` | array | `[]` | Match any phrase across trade/generic name, applicant, supplement reason and approval statement. |
| `applicants` | array | `[]` | Restrict results to one or more device applicants. |
| `productCodes` | array | `[]` | Restrict results to FDA product codes. |
| `decisionDateFrom` | string | `"2026-08-01"` | Inclusive YYYY-MM-DD lower bound. |
| `decisionDateTo` | string | `"2026-08-31"` | Inclusive YYYY-MM-DD upper bound. |
| `recordKinds` | array | `["original","supplement"]` | Choose original approvals and/or supplements. |
| `onlyApproved` | boolean | `true` | Keep APPR and accepted 30-day notice decisions. |
| `minimumMateriality` | string | `"all"` | Filter supplements by deterministic business/regulatory materiality. |
| `maxItems` | integer | `100` | Maximum PMA decisions to store. |
